Operational Order
Opposed Towing of Craft
fil.
604
Situation
1.
On occasion, there is a need to tow out of Territorial waters
certain vessels which are refused the right to enter, or stay, in Hong
Kong. In these circumstances opposition is to be expected. This
opposition may take the form of physical resistance to the boarding
party, cutting of tow ropes etc, or the persons on board may render the
vessel unseaworthy, or attempt to scuttle it. The types of vessel
involved will range from small sailing or motorised craft up to coasters
cr traders. They may also be in need of refuelling and re-provisioning before they can be expelled from Territorial waters.
2.
The authority for such action will come from Col Polmil to
MARPOL. The actual operation will involve Royal Navy vessels who will
do all towing outside Territorial waters and Mardep who will be involved
in assessing the seaworthiness of these vessels.
3.
Launches of the logistic unit will carry out the tow in HK
waters when available, otherwise Sector launches will perform the task.

Execution
General Outline
5.
The vessels to be removed will fall into two categories..
First, those that are on or near the Territorial boundary and the second, those which have already entered Hong Kong and are detained at
a quarantine anchorage or other place within the Harbour area.
